Overview

An action, indie, massively multiplayer game by BlackMill Games, published by BlackMill Games — single-player, multi-player, pvp, online pvp.

Steam’s own one-line description: “Merciless trench warfare immerses you and your squad in intense battles of attack and defense. Verdun is the first multiplayer FPS set in an authentic World War One setting offering a rarely seen battlefield experience.” — developer/publisher text via the Steam store page.

System requirements (PC)

As published on the Steam store page. Requirements can change between updates.

Minimum

  • OS *: Windows 8/10
  • Processor: Intel CPU Core i5-2500K 3.3GHz, AMD CPU Phenom II X4 940
  • Memory: 4 GB RAM
  • Graphics: Geforce GTX 960M / Radeon HD 7750 or higher, 1GB video card memory
  • DirectX: Version 10
  • Network: Broadband Internet connection
  • Storage: 12 GB available space
  • Additional Notes: Multiplayer only, make sure you have a stable and fast internet connection.

Recommended

  • Memory: 8 GB RAM
  • Graphics: 4GB video card memory
